Who selects a local superintendent of schools in Georgia?

The selection of a local superintendent of schools in Georgia is the responsibility of the Board of Education. This structure is established to ensure that local communities have a significant say in the management of their educational systems. The Board of Education, consisting of elected members, governs the school district and is tasked with appointing the superintendent, who will then implement the policies and vision of the board. This local control allows for a more responsive and tailored approach to education, reflecting the specific needs and priorities of the community regarding its schools. This system emphasizes the importance of local governance in educational administration.
